Warriors coach Steve Kerr praised the young guard’s character and level-headedness throughout all the chaos and reiterated how purposeful everything has played out. “I mean there’s a reason Jordan is where he is right now,” Kerr told reporters Sunday. “Especially when you consider where he was coming out of Michigan as a late first-round pick. Struggling his first few months in the league. There’s a reason he’s in this position, about to sign a big extension hopefully.” Poole dropped a team-high 25 points on 52.6 percent shooting from the field and 33 percent from 3-point range. He also dished out six assists and grabbed four boards in the 124-121 loss to a LeBron James-less Lakers squad at Chase Center on Sunday. During practice last Wednesday, it was first reported that there was an altercation between Poole and Green in which the latter “forcefully struck” the former, and that’s really all that was known. But less than 48 hours later, a video obtained and published by TMZ Sports showed Green punching Poole and knocking him to the ground, thus changing everything. It went from an internal issue in a closed practice to the hands of anyone and everyone with a smartphone. While Poole has yet to address the matter, even though Green, Kerr and other Warriors teammates have, his actions on the court definitely spoke volumes. “The guy’s tough,” Kerr said. “He’s mentally tough, he’s physically tough.
